Ohno Yoshimitsu's Profile
His real name is Yoshikawa Mitsuo, and his mentors are Yoshiwara Yoshindo and Kuniye. He pursued the replication of the Ichimonji Sanchomo, a national treasure tachi handed down in the Uesugi family, and completed a work of art that surpassed even the original in quality. In particular, his hamon, a jukachoji called Ohno Choji, has received worldwide acclaim. His skills are unsurpassed among modern swordsmiths, and the precision of the work he produces is outstanding.
